Erika Kirk Addresses Relationship Rumors: What She’s Said About Her Dating Life

Erika Kirk, the widow of Turning Point USA founder Charlie Kirk, is facing new criticism online after a social media account claimed she had moved on romantically and was seen getting close with Blake Wynn, a friend of her late husband and nephew of casino mogul Steve Wynn. The allegation spread quickly after the account “Project Constitution” posted that the two were spotted together at an exclusive Beverly Hills hotel, where they were said to be hugging, kissing, and acting intimately. The post also alleged that Erika had been drinking and had been seen shopping with Wynn earlier in the day. It further claimed that multiple photos of the pair together suggested an existing relationship.
Erika Kirk swiftly rejected the accusations, calling them completely false. In her response, she said that Charlie Kirk’s love would remain with her for life and that only religion could fill the void left by his death. She stated that on May 14 she was at home in Arizona celebrating her son’s second birthday, directly contradicting the timeline in the viral post. Erika also clarified that Blake Wynn was a longtime friend of her husband, not her boyfriend, and said he was about to be engaged to his longtime girlfriend. She accused the account of spreading lies and harassment and ended her message with a dismissive insult.
Blake Wynn also publicly denied the claims. In a response of his own, he said he was not dating Erika Kirk and mocked the people circulating the rumor as bots and users inventing stories under the cover of journalism.
The controversy has intensified attention on Erika Kirk, who has already been a target of criticism from some conservatives since Charlie Kirk’s death. While many supporters treated Charlie Kirk as a martyr-like figure, some of the same political circles have since expressed frustration with his widow, criticizing her parenting, her management of Turning Point USA, and her public image. The latest rumor has added to that backlash, even though both Erika Kirk and Blake Wynn have denied any romantic relationship.
